Re: [Flexradio] M 44 breakout box replacement?

2008-02-12 Thread Tim Ellison
The breakout box eliminator (BOBE) does not necessarily use the 15-pin cable. You can (and I recommend) you plug it directly into the D44 card and use well shielded stereo audio cables (1/8" (3.5mm) TRS male plugs on both ends) for the to line in and to line out connections between the SDR1K an
